hibernate更新语句返回的类型 return一个循环能返回几个值?
return一个循环能返回几个值?
return两个运行能返回一个值。
return特点的:
1.当函数想执行完return语句那以后,意思是函数不能执行结束后,return后面的代码应该不会不能执行。
语句不能前往1次。
return想要返回多个数据,必须生克制化容器类型建议使用,把多个要赶往的数据弄到容器类型里面,赶往容器类型的数据即可。
函数Time()返回值的数据类型是什么?
time返回值类型为time_t
返回值概念:两个函数的函数名必是该函数的代表,都是另一个变量。由于函数名变量通常利用把函数的处理结果数据带回给调用函数,即递归过程内部函数,因为像是把函数名变量称为返回值。
在C中,函数也可以有返回值,也可以也没返回值。是对没有返回值的函数,功能只不过结束另一个操作,应将返回值类型定义,定义为void,函数体内可以不还没有return语句,当不需要在程序指定位置再次时,这个可以在该处储放一个。
在PHP中,值按照在用可选的返回语句回。一丁点类型都是可以前往,3个坦克师列表和对象。这倒致函数马上都结束了它的运行,而且将控制权传信回它被内部函数的行。
Hibernate中update和merge的区别?
事实上,这两个方法,是有太大区别的首先,这对一个正处于detatch状态的实体对象来讲,要将其中的修改,不合并到数据库中,有两种方法,一种,是动态创建restore(),另一种是全局函数merge()当内部函数restore()时,简单要判缓刑目标session中,不包含同时id的七彩对象的脚注,要是有的是话,会丢出无比,结束update()方法后,这个实体对象从detatch状态,可以转换为persistent状态,在session递交前,妖军对其的修改,都会被不合并到数据库中。当全局函数merge()对象时,不必确定session中是否是巳经包含同样id的实体对象,如果没有session中没有同时id的实体对象,hibernate会实际select语句,从数据库中网上查询出随机对象,如果不是数据库中还没有按对象,就新建任务一个。同样,完成merge()操作后,会赶往数据库中填写的persistent状态对象,而重新组合的,充当参数传出的实体对象,仍然是detatch状态,后续代码对其的修改,根本无法扩展到数据库中。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。